Health Benefits of Creamy Vegan Avocado Sauce
Who says healthy can’t be delicious? Our Creamy Vegan Avocado Sauce isn’t just a treat for your taste buds – it’s a powerhouse of nutrition that can boost your overall wellbeing. From heart-healthy fats to essential vitamins and minerals, this sauce packs a punch when it comes to health benefits. Let’s dive into the ways this green goodness can contribute to your health and vitality.
- Heart-Healthy Fats: Avocados are rich in monounsaturated fats, which can help lower bad cholesterol levels and reduce the risk of heart disease.
- Nutrient Dense: Avocados provide nearly 20 vitamins and minerals, including potassium, vitamin K, vitamin C, and folate.
- High in Fiber: The fiber in avocados aids digestion and helps maintain a healthy gut.
- Antioxidant Powerhouse: Cilantro and lime juice are excellent sources of antioxidants, which help protect your cells from damage.
- Anti-Inflammatory Properties: Cumin and garlic have natural anti-inflammatory effects.
- Low in Saturated Fat: As a vegan recipe, it’s naturally low in saturated fat compared to dairy-based sauces.
- Promotes Satiety: The combination of healthy fats and fiber can help you feel full and satisfied, potentially aiding in weight management.
- Supports Eye Health: Avocados contain lutein and zeaxanthin, antioxidants that are important for eye health.
- Enhances Nutrient Absorption: The healthy fats in avocados can help your body absorb fat-soluble nutrients from other foods.
- Versatile Nutrition: By using this sauce in various ways, you can easily increase your intake of vegetables and other healthy foods.

Creamy Vegan Avocado Sauce
Course: Lunch, Dinner, SaucesCuisine: MediterraneanDifficulty: Easy8
servings10
minutes120
kcalIngredients
2 ripe avocados
1/4 cup fresh cilantro, chopped
2 tablespoons fresh lime juice
2 cloves garlic, minced
1/4 cup unsweetened plant-based milk (such as almond or oat milk)
2 tablespoons extra virgin olive oil
1/2 teaspoon ground cumin
1/4 teaspoon smoked paprika
Salt and black pepper to taste
Optional: 1 small jalapeño pepper, seeded and finely chopped (for heat)
Directions
- Cut the avocados in half, remove the pits, and scoop the flesh into a food processor or high-speed blender.
- Add the chopped cilantro, lime juice, minced garlic, plant-based milk, olive oil, cumin, and smoked paprika to the food processor.
- If using, add the chopped jalapeño pepper for extra heat.
- Blend the ingredients until smooth and creamy, scraping down the sides of the processor as needed.
- Taste the sauce and add salt and black pepper as desired. Blend again briefly to incorporate.
- If the sauce is too thick, add more plant-based milk, one tablespoon at a time, until you reach your desired consistency.
- Transfer the sauce to a bowl and serve immediately, or cover tightly with plastic wrap (pressing it directly onto the surface of the sauce to prevent browning) and refrigerate until ready to use.
Note:
- This sauce is best consumed within 1-2 days for optimal freshness and color. Store in an airtight container in the refrigerator.

Detailed Uses:
- Vegan Pasta Perfection Transform your favorite vegan noodles into a gourmet meal by tossing them with our Creamy Vegan Avocado Sauce. The sauce clings beautifully to pasta, creating a luscious, creamy dish without any dairy. Try it with spaghetti, penne, or even zucchini noodles for a low-carb option. Add some cherry tomatoes and pine nuts for extra texture and flavor.
- Veggie Dip Delight Serve this sauce as a vibrant and healthy dip at your next gathering. Pair it with a colorful array of fresh vegetables like carrot sticks, cucumber slices, bell pepper strips, and cherry tomatoes. For a crunchier option, serve with vegan tortilla chips. The creamy texture and zesty flavor make it an irresistible crowd-pleaser.
- Sandwich Spread Sensation Elevate your vegan sandwiches and wraps by using this sauce as a spread. It adds a creamy texture and burst of flavor that can transform a simple sandwich into a gourmet treat. Try it on a vegan BLT, veggie wrap, or even a grilled vegetable panini.
- Roasted Veggie and Taco Topper Drizzle the sauce over roasted vegetables to add a creamy, flavorful finish. It pairs particularly well with roasted sweet potatoes, Brussels sprouts, or cauliflower. For Taco Tuesday, use it as a zesty topping for vegan tacos. The sauce complements spicy fillings and adds a cool, creamy contrast.
- Zesty Salad Dressing Create a delicious vegan salad dressing by thinning out the sauce with additional lime juice or plant-based milk. This creates a pourable consistency perfect for dressing salads. It works wonderfully on mixed greens, kale salads, or even as a dressing for a vegan coleslaw. Adjust the thickness to your liking for the perfect salad companion.
